With an anticipated bollard pull of concerning 100 tonnes in diesel-mechanical setting when consisting of battery increase ability, the pull will certainly be one of the most effective icebreaking companion pull of this dimension worldwide with hybrid/electrical propulsion

OCTOBER 9, 2018– Spain’s Gondan Shipbuilding the other day introduced a crossbreed icebreaking pull for the Port of Lule å,Sweden Designed by Robert Allan Ltd the RAL EXPANSE 3600-H course pull is completely personalized for the port’s demands.

The 36 m vessel has a hull framework that surpasses Finnish-Swedish ice course policies as well as can damaging 1 meter of ice at a rate of approximately 3 knots. In enhancement icebreaking it is created to bring ouy ice monitoring, companion, ship-assist, seaside towing, fire-fighting as well as navigating help solution responsibilities.

Spain’s Gondan Shipbuilding will certainly be the very first vessel in procedure with a Wärtsilä HY crossbreed power option. It will certainly include 2 Wärtsilä HY 2 hybrid power components that will certainly provide both ecological advantages as well as functional as well as adaptability benefits.

The Wärtsilä HY range consists of a power monitoring system that enhances the consolidated use the engines, the power storage space systems, as well as the power circulation train. The mechanical equipment component is based upon 2 Wärtsilä 26 engines. The Wärtsilä range likewise consists of the pull’s incorporated automation as well as security system.

The pull will certainly can operating electric battery power when en route. Although it is set up as a mechanical set up, the “hybrid diesel-electric” setting will certainly enable the variety of prime moving companies made use of to be minimized to simply one for numerous functional jobs. These consist of ship help with a bollard pull of approximately 55 lots, or 90 lots on 2 primary engines in diesel-mechanical setting. A bollard pull of 100 lots will certainly be readily available when in battery increase setting.

The vessel will certainly can being totally independent from added fee centers, as re-charging of the power storage space system will certainly be instantly taken care of by the Energy Management System, the “brain” of the Wärtsilä HY. In enhancement, the set up onshore electric link will certainly offer the pull the adaptability to charge the power storage space system, also when the pull is berthed at the quay.
